People have been writing messages into the Bitcoin blockchain since 2009 — memorials, proposals, prayers, protests, jokes. Once written they cannot be edited or deleted, so the chain remembers them all.
1,295,382 messages archived from 960,519 blocks (genesis → 960,518), updated as each new block lands.
